The Techno India is a group of engineering and management colleges, universities, high schools and primary schools. Techno Model High School and Techno India Group Public School are located in different towns and cities in West Bengal. Each district of West Bengal has one public school by Techno. It also offers undergraduate and postgraduate programs in the field of Science, engineering, technology, computer application, management, architecture, pharmacy, humanities, law, commerce, etc. The main campus of the college is situated in Salt Lake City in Kolkata, West Bengal. The college is an AICTE-approved institution and is affiliated to Maulana Abul Kalam Azad University of Technology. [1] Techno India's Main Salt Lake Campus is the flagship college and the main placement centre for the Techno India group of colleges in West Bengal. [2]

Techno International New Town Engineering college in West Bengal, India

Techno International Newtown, formerly Known as Techno India College Of Technology(TICT), is an engineering college in West Bengal, India. It is the seventh and youngest college established by the Techno India Group. The college is located on 5 acres (20,000 m2) of land in the Megacity area of Rajarhat, Kolkata. It is affiliated with Maulana Abul Kalam Azad University of Technology(formerly known as West Bengal University of Technology) and its courses are approved by All India Council of Technical Education.

Maulana Abul Kalam Azad Institute of Asian Studies

Maulana Abul Kalam Azad Institute of Asian Studies is an autonomous research institute based in Calcutta. It is funded by the Ministry of Culture of the Government of India. It was founded on 4 January 1993. The foundation stone of the institute was laid where the new building now stands on 12 March 1993. It is devoted to the study of the life and works of Maulana Abul Kalam Azad, the eminent nationalist leader and India's first education minister, after whom it is named, and to the furtherance of Area Studies, with special reference to South Asia, Central Asia and West Asia, especially dealing with social, cultural, economic, political and administrative developments in Asia from the nineteenth century to the present. M.Phil.- and Ph.D.-level students of the University of Calcutta, Jadavpur University and Jawaharlal Nehru University, New Delhi are also associated with it.
